如何设置Google Analytics事件跟踪,完整指南
- 引言
- Google Analytics事件跟踪?">1. 什么是Google Analytics事件跟踪?
- 2. 事件跟踪的基本结构
- 4" title="3. 如何设置Google Analytics事件跟踪?">3. 如何设置Google Analytics事件跟踪?
- 4. 如何验证事件跟踪是否生效?
- 最佳实践">5. 事件跟踪的最佳实践
- 解决方案">6. 常见问题与解决方案
- 7. 结论
在数字营销和网站分析中,了解用户行为至关重要,Google Analytics(GA)提供了强大的事件跟踪功能,帮助网站所有者监测用户交互,如按钮点击、表单提交、视频播放等,通过正确设置事件跟踪,你可以获取更深入的数据洞察,优化用户体验并提高转化率。
本文将详细介绍如何设置Google Analytics事件跟踪,包括基本概念、实施方法、代码示例以及最佳实践,帮助你充分利用这一功能。
什么是Google Analytics事件跟踪?
事件跟踪是Google Analytics的一项功能,用于记录用户在网站上的特定交互行为,这些行为可以包括:
- 点击按钮或链接
- 表单提交
- 视频播放或暂停
- 文件下载
- 滚动深度
- 社交媒体分享
事件跟踪数据可以帮助你分析用户行为,优化网站设计,并改进营销策略。
事件跟踪的基本结构
在Google Analytics中,每个事件由四个主要参数组成:
- Category(类别) – 事件的分类,如“视频”、“按钮”或“表单”。
- Action(动作) – 用户的具体行为,如“播放”、“点击”或“提交”。
- Label(标签) – 事件的额外描述信息,如按钮名称或视频标题(可选)。
- Value(值) – 事件的数值,如视频观看时长或点击次数(可选)。
示例:
ga('send', 'event', 'Video', 'Play', 'Tutorial Video', 120);
- Category: "Video"
- Action: "Play"
- Label: "Tutorial Video"
- Value: 120(秒)
如何设置Google Analytics事件跟踪?
方法1:使用Google Tag Manager(推荐)
Google Tag Manager(GTM)可以简化事件跟踪的部署,无需手动修改代码。
步骤1:创建触发器
- 登录GTM账户,进入“触发器”页面。
- 点击“新建”,选择触发器类型(如“点击”、“表单提交”或“滚动深度”)。
- 配置触发器条件(如“所有链接点击”或特定CSS选择器)。
步骤2:创建标签
- 进入“标签”页面,点击“新建”。
- 选择“Google Analytics: Universal Analytics”标签类型。
- 设置“Track Type”为“Event”。
- 填写事件参数(Category、Action、Label、Value)。
- 关联之前创建的触发器。
步骤3:发布更改
- 点击“提交”并发布容器。
- 在Google Analytics实时报告中验证事件是否触发。
方法2:手动添加JavaScript代码
如果你不使用GTM,可以直接在网页代码中添加事件跟踪。
示例:跟踪按钮点击
<button onclick="trackButtonClick()">Download PDF</button> <script> function trackButtonClick() { ga('send', 'event', 'Download', 'Click', 'PDF Guide'); } </script>
- Category: "Download"
- Action: "Click"
- Label: "PDF Guide"
示例:跟踪表单提交
document.getElementById('contact-form').addEventListener('submit', function() { ga('send', 'event', 'Form', 'Submit', 'Contact Form'); });
方法3:使用Google Analytics 4(GA4)事件跟踪
GA4引入了更灵活的事件模型,不再强制使用Category/Action/Label结构。
在GA4中设置事件
- 进入Google Analytics 4后台。
- 点击“配置” > “事件”。
- 点击“创建事件”并定义事件名称和参数。
示例代码(GA4)
gtag('event', 'download', { 'file_name': 'ebook.pdf' });
- 事件名称: "download"
- 参数: "file_name" = "ebook.pdf"
如何验证事件跟踪是否生效?
方法1:使用Google Analytics实时报告
- 进入GA > 实时 > 事件。
- 触发事件(如点击按钮)。
- 查看事件是否出现在报告中。
方法2:使用Google Tag Assistant
- 安装Chrome扩展“Google Tag Assistant”。
- 访问你的网站并触发事件。
- 检查Tag Assistant是否记录事件。
方法3:使用浏览器开发者工具
- 按 F12 打开开发者工具。
- 进入 Network 选项卡,筛选 collect 请求。
- 检查请求参数是否包含事件数据。
事件跟踪的最佳实践
- 命名规范:保持Category/Action/Label命名一致,如“Video-Play-Tutorial”。
- 避免重复事件:确保同一行为不会多次触发(如防止重复表单提交)。
- 使用GTM管理事件:减少代码依赖,便于更新。
- 结合目标转化:在GA中设置目标,将关键事件(如购买、注册)与转化关联。
- 定期审核数据:检查事件数据是否准确,避免遗漏或错误。
常见问题与解决方案
Q1:事件没有出现在GA报告中?
- 检查代码是否正确部署。
- 确保GA跟踪ID正确。
- 验证GTM是否已发布。
Q2:如何跟踪外部链接点击?
在GTM中设置“链接点击”触发器,并过滤外部URL。
Q3:GA4和Universal Analytics事件跟踪有什么区别?
GA4采用事件驱动模型,无需预定义事件结构,而Universal Analytics需要Category/Action/Label。
Google Analytics事件跟踪是分析用户行为的重要工具,通过GTM、手动代码或GA4,你可以轻松设置事件跟踪,优化网站体验并提高转化率,遵循最佳实践,定期检查数据,确保你的分析准确有效。
你可以开始设置事件跟踪,深入挖掘用户行为数据,做出更明智的决策! 🚀
-
喜欢(11)
-
不喜欢(1)